Notation

see synonyms of notation

Noun

1. notation, notational system

a technical system of symbols used to represent special things

2. annotation, notation, note

a comment or instruction (usually added)

Example Sentences:
'his notes were appended at the end of the article'
'he added a short notation to the address on the envelope'

3. notation

the activity of representing something by a special system of marks or characters

Notation

see synonyms of notation
noun
1. 
any series of signs or symbols used to represent quantities or elements in a specialized system, such as music or mathematics
2. 
the act or process of notating
3. 
a. 
the act of noting down
b. 
a note or record

Notation

see synonyms of notation
noun
1. 
the use of a system of signs or symbols to represent words, phrases, numbers, quantities, etc.
2. 
any such system of signs or symbols, as in mathematics, chemistry, music, etc.
3. 
a brief note jotted down, as to remind one of something, explain something, etc.
4. 
the act of noting something in writing

Notation

see synonyms of notation
n.
1.
a. A system of figures or symbols used in a specialized field to represent numbers, quantities, tones, or values: musical notation.
b. The act or process of using such a system.
2. A brief note; an annotation: marginal notations.
